Many of digital compact cameras made by Panasonic, such as the DMC-ZS3/DMC-TZ7, DMC-FT1, DMC-FZ35/DMC-FZ38, DMC-FX75/DMC FX70 and DMC-ZS-7/TZ-10 offer 720p video recording with effective frame rate of 25 or 30 frames/s in a format called AVCHD Lite. This AVCHD specification supports 720-line progressive recording mode at frame rates of 24 and 60 frames/s for 60 Hz models and 50 frames/s for 50 Hz models. Compared to HDV 720p, AVCHD uses higher data rate (up to 24 Mbit/s VBR vs. 18.3 Mbit/s CBR) and a more advanced compression format (AVC vs. MPEG-2).

Most of us would choose DMC-TZ10/TZ7/ZS7/FX75/FX70 AVCHD Lite as the recording mode, as it provides high quality videos. However, the compatibility for AVCHD lite and Mac is not very good, it is not easy to read/play/edit movies in this format on Mac, as it requires high configuration to handle DMC-TZ10/TZ7/ZS7/FX75/FX70 AVCHD Lite videos.
